Diana Ross Says She Felt Violated By TSA Agents: " I Was Treated Like Shit"
Ross talked about her experience in a series of tweets.
On Sunday (May 5th) legendary singer Diana Ross alleged that she was mistreated by the Transportation Security Administration while leaving New Orleans. In a series of tweets, Ross, who was coming back from the New Orleans Jazz and Heritage Festival, wrote that she "was treated like shit" and the experience with TSA "makes her want to cry."

According to CNN, a TSA spokesperson said they were looking into the claims but an initial review of the tape found nothing out of the ordinary. The TSA spokesperson said: "the officers involved with Ms. Ross's screening correctly followed all protocols, however, TSA will continue to investigate the matter further."
